Abstract
This document provides the framework of requirements for text conversation with real time character-by-character interactive flow over the IP network using the Session Initiation Protocol. The requirements for general real-time text-over-IP telephony, point-to- point and conference calls, transcoding, relay services, user mobility, interworking between text-over-IP telephony and existing text-telephony, and some special features including instant messaging have been described.
